Users of Apple’s Safari browser will be pleased to learn that Apple has today rolled out a new update for its Safari browser, taking it to version 5.1.2. The new Safari update brings with it stability improvements, together with memory leak fixes and additional features.
Enhanced Stability and Performance
As well as stability and memory leak fixes, the new update also brings with it support for web pages, now allowing developers to show PDF content inline with the rest of the site’s web content. This means that users can now view PDF documents directly within the browser window without needing to download them or open them in a separate application. This feature is particularly useful for users who frequently access PDF files online, such as academic papers, reports, and e-books.
The stability improvements in Safari 5.1.2 are designed to provide a smoother and more reliable browsing experience. Users who have experienced crashes or slow performance in previous versions will likely notice a significant improvement. Memory leak fixes are also a crucial part of this update, as they help to prevent the browser from consuming excessive amounts of memory over time, which can lead to sluggish performance and system instability.

You can now download the new Safari 5.1.2 browser from the Apple website. The update is around 40MB in size and will require a restart to take effect. This ensures that all the new features and improvements are properly integrated into the browser.
